Dr. Larry Shears serves as Chief of Cardiothoracic Surgery and Co-Director of the UT Erlanger Heart and Lung Institute. He is a leading specialist in robotic cardiothoracic surgery, performing bypasses and other major heart surgeries without opening the chest. This minimally invasive approach – performing coronary artery bypass surgery and valve replacements through three small incisions – has changed the entire philosophy regarding cardiothoracic surgery. It provides patients with an option that allows them to return to daily activities much sooner after surgery, with less pain and fewer complications. Dr. Shears' specialties include:
